Senate Bill 127 would require the state to negotiate funding for law enforcement on the reservation with Lake County every other year. The Legislature passed a bill last session paving the way for the state to pay Lake County for its law enforcement services, but did not appropriate any funds. POST (Peace Officers Standards and Training Council) is administratively attached to the Department of Justice and establishes basic and advanced qualifications and training standards for employment of Montanas public safety officers. Information Technology Services Division provides a full range of information technology and criminal justice services for the department including system development and maintenance of motor vehicle titling and registration systems, driver license and history system, criminal history record information system and the Sexual and Violent Offender Registry. Central Services Division provides the administrative, personnel, budgetary, accounting, and fiscal support for the department. As with any other type of emergency situation, the telecommunicator plays a vital role in the response to active shooter incidents.As the providers of communications capabilities and responder safety, telecommunicators should be aware of the unique challenges posed by active shooter incidents and be prepared to address them well in advance.This course helps to educate telecommunicators about the many intricate issues and challenges posed by active shooter incidents and their response and the role the telecommunicator plays in each. Division of Criminal Investigation investigates crimes, provides for fire safety inspections, and provides officer training including operation of the Montana Law Enforcement Academy.
